,可以通过以下步骤实现:
- 首先,确保已经在GTM中创建了一个自定义HTML标签。
- 在自定义HTML标签中,使用JavaScript代码来遍历JSON-ld模式。可以使用JavaScript的forEach方法来遍历JSON对象中的每个属性。
- 在JavaScript代码中,首先获取JSON-ld模式的元素。可以使用GTM的内置变量
{{JSON-LD Variable}}
来获取JSON-ld模式的值。 - 使用JavaScript的JSON.parse方法将JSON-ld模式的值解析为JavaScript对象。
- 使用forEach方法遍历JSON对象的属性。在forEach的回调函数中,可以获取每个属性的键和值,并进行相应的操作。
- 在遍历过程中,可以根据需要执行各种操作,例如将属性值存储到变量中、发送到Google Analytics等。
- 最后,将自定义HTML标签添加到GTM的相应触发器中,以便在特定事件发生时触发标签执行。
需要注意的是,GTM是一种标签管理系统,用于在网站上添加和管理各种标签,包括JavaScript代码。通过使用GTM,可以方便地在网站上添加和更新代码,而无需直接修改网站的源代码。
JSON-ld是一种用于在网页上标记结构化数据的格式。它是一种基于JSON的语法,用于描述实体之间的关系和属性。通过在网页上添加JSON-ld模式,可以帮助搜索引擎理解网页内容,并提供更丰富的搜索结果。
在GTM中使用JS foreach遍历JSON-ld模式的优势包括:
- 灵活性:通过使用自定义HTML标签和JavaScript代码,可以根据具体需求自定义遍历和处理JSON-ld模式的逻辑。
- 可扩展性:GTM提供了丰富的内置变量和功能,可以与其他标签和触发器结合使用,实现更复杂的数据处理和分析需求。
- 简化管理:通过将代码逻辑集中在GTM中,可以更方便地管理和更新JSON-ld模式的处理逻辑,而无需直接修改网站代码。
在实际应用中,使用GTM遍历JSON-ld模式可以用于各种场景,例如:
- 数据收集和分析:可以将JSON-ld模式中的数据发送到Google Analytics或其他分析工具,用于统计和分析网站的用户行为和属性。
- 动态内容展示:根据JSON-ld模式中的数据,可以动态地展示相关内容,例如根据用户的地理位置显示不同的产品信息。
- SEO优化:通过在网页上添加JSON-ld模式,可以帮助搜索引擎更好地理解和索引网页内容,提高网页在搜索结果中的排名。
腾讯云提供了一系列与云计算相关的产品和服务,可以帮助用户构建和管理云端应用。具体推荐的腾讯云产品和产品介绍链接地址可以根据具体需求和场景进行选择。